Romance scams occur when fraudsters create fake profiles on dating sites or social media platforms and develop a relationship with the victim to gain their trust and eventually trick them into sending money. To prevent romance scams, here are some measures that you can take:
- Be cautious: If someone you don’t know sends you a message on a dating site or social media platform, be cautious. Don’t give them your personal information, such as your address or financial information.
- Verify their identity: Use online tools to verify their identity. Reverse image search their profile picture to see if it’s being used elsewhere.
- Don’t send money: Never send money to someone you met online, especially if you haven’t met them in person.
- Report suspicious behaviour: If you suspect someone is a fraudster, report them to the dating site or social media platform.
By following these measures, you can protect yourself from falling victim to a romance scam.
